High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ors Market Insights

High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ors market size was valued at USD 292 million in 2025. The market is forecasted to increase from USD 292 million in 2025 to USD 359 million by 2032, exhibiting a CAGR of 3.0% during the forecast period.

High‑voltage carbon film resistors are fixed resistors formed by depositing a carbon film on a ceramic or glass substrate; resistance values are set through helical trimming while a specialised coating improves voltage‑withstand capability. Their high rated voltages, strong pulse‑handling capacity and stable temperature characteristics make them ideal for current limiting and voltage regulation in power supplies, voltage dividers, medical imaging systems, industrial control equipment and related high‑voltage applications.The market gains traction because expanding renewable‑energy projects, electric‑vehicle power electronics and high‑voltage testing apparatus raise demand for reliable voltage‑limiting components. Meanwhile, competition from metal‑film and thick‑film alternatives pressures pricing structures. Manufacturers in Japan, Europe and North America concentrate on high‑reliability niches, whereas firms in Taiwan and mainland China exploit scale advantages for mass markets; recent moves such as Yageo’s acquisition of a Taiwanese thin‑film resistor line in early 2024 illustrate strategic efforts to broaden portfolios while preserving gross margins that typically range between 18 % and 28 %.

MARKET DRIVERS

Rising Demand in Power‑Conversion Systems

 

High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ors Market is benefiting from the surge in power‑conversion architectures that require precise voltage regulation at elevated potentials. Designers of industrial drives, renewable‑energy inverters, and aerospace power units are opting for carbon‑film technology because it delivers stable resistance over wide voltage ranges while maintaining a compact footprint. This shift translates into higher unit shipments for manufacturers that can guarantee tight tolerance and low noise performance.

Stringent Reliability Requirements

Regulatory bodies and OEM quality programs are tightening acceptance criteria for components that operate above 5 kV. Carbon‑film resistors are favoured for their ability to withstand repetitive voltage spikes without degradation of resistance value. Companies that invest in advanced annealing processes and rigorous burn‑in testing are capturing a larger share of contracts where long‑term reliability is non‑negotiable.

Clients that integrate high‑temperature‑stable carbon‑film parts report a measurable drop in field failures, driving repeat orders.

These dynamics are compelling equipment makers to re‑evaluate their bill of materials, favouring suppliers that combine high voltage capability with proven endurance. As a result, the competitive landscape is increasingly defined by technical differentiation rather than price alone.

MARKET CHALLENGES

 

Cost Sensitivity in High‑Volume Applications

 

While performance advantages are clear, many manufacturers face pressure to lower component costs in mass‑production environments such as consumer‑grade power supplies. Carbon‑film resistors, especially those rated for >10 kV, carry higher material and processing expenses than standard metal‑film equivalents, creating a tension between specification fidelity and budget constraints.

Other Challenges

Supply Chain Volatility

Fluctuations in specialty carbon feedstock and the limited number of foundries capable of producing ultra‑high‑voltage films have introduced lead‑time uncertainties. End‑users must plan inventory more conservatively, which can dampen order velocity in the short term.

MARKET RESTRAINTS

Thermal‑Coefficient Limitations

 

Carbon‑film resistors exhibit a higher temperature coefficient of resistance (TCR) compared with some ceramic or metal‑oxide alternatives. In applications where ambient temperature swings exceed ±50 °C, this characteristic can compromise circuit precision, prompting designers to resort to alternative technologies despite the voltage advantage of carbon film.

MARKET OPPORTUNITIES

Growth of Electric‑Vehicle Power Trains

 

The migration toward electric‑vehicle platforms introduces a new class of high‑voltage subsystemon‑board chargers, DC‑DC converters, and motor‑controller modulesthat demand reliable resistance values at potentials up to 12 kV. Manufacturers that can certify carbon‑film resistors for automotive‑grade durability are poised to secure long‑term supply contracts in this rapidly evolving sector.

High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ors Market Trends

Elevated Demand from Power‑Electronics Platforms

High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ors Market is seeing a steady lift as manufacturers of renewable‑energy inverters and automotive chargers require components that can sustain high pulse currents while maintaining tight tolerance. The 292 million‑dollar valuation recorded in 2025 and the forecasted rise toward roughly 359 million dollars by 2032 reflect a market that is absorbing incremental volume without dramatic spikes. Production volumes of about 2,667 million units at an average price of $0.12 illustrate a cost structure where economies of scale are preserving margin windows of 18 % to 28 %. The trend is underpinned by the need for reliable voltage‑division networks in grid‑tie converters, where failure rates translate directly into costly downtime. Consequently, suppliers that can guarantee consistent coating integrity and precise helical trimming are gaining preference, prompting mid‑stream firms to invest in tighter process controls.

Other Trends

Supply Landscape Shift

Fragmentation remains a hallmark of High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ors Market, yet a subtle re‑balancing is evident. Traditional players in Japan, Europe, and North America continue to dominate high‑reliability niches such as medical imaging and defense‑grade equipment, leveraging long‑standing expertise in low‑noise, temperature‑stable designs. Meanwhile, manufacturers in Taiwan and mainland China are consolidating capacitynow exceeding 3,500 million unitsto serve bulk industrial power‑supply applications where price competitiveness is paramount. This dichotomy creates a two‑tier ecosystem: the “first tier” focuses on differentiated performance, while the “second tier” capitalizes on volume and cost efficiency. The divergence compels original equipment manufacturers to adopt a dual‑sourcing strategy, pairing premium‑grade parts for critical subsystems with cost‑optimized units for less sensitive blocks.

Regional Innovation Hotspots

Geographically, Asia is emerging as the primary arena for product development, driven by accelerated rollout of electric‑vehicle charging infrastructure and aggressive industrial automation programs. In China, the convergence of local government incentives and a dense supplier base has accelerated the introduction of sulfurization‑resistant structures, addressing reliability concerns in high‑temperature environments. Europe, however, retains a niche advantage in standards‑intensive sectors, where compliance with stringent medical‑device regulations fuels demand for ultra‑stable resistors. North America’s focus on legacy power‑distribution upgrades sustains a modest but steady flow of orders. These regional dynamics suggest that firms capable of tailoring their portfolios to distinct regulatory and performance expectations will be best positioned to capture incremental share as the market matures.

COMPETITIVE LANDSCAPE

Key Industry Players

High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ors – Competitive Overview

The market is anchored by a handful of multinational firms that dominate the high‑reliability segment. Yageo Corporation, Vishay Intertechnology and KOA Corporation leverage extensive product catalogs and distribution networks to secure long‑term contracts with power‑supply OEMs, medical‑imaging equipment makers, and defense contractors. Their ability to combine precise trimming technology with robust coating processes yields low failure rates, a decisive factor for customers who cannot tolerate downtime. Consequently, these players capture a disproportionate share of the premium pricing tier, translating into gross margins that comfortably exceed 20 %.Beyond the first tier, a sizable second tier of Asian manufacturers competes aggressively on cost and volume. Companies such as Panasonic Holdings, TT Electronics, Ohmite Manufacturing, Stackpole Electronics, Kamaya Electric, Fenghua Advanced Technology, Caddock Electronics, MIBA Resistors, Littelfuse, Murata Manufacturing, Rohm Semiconductor and AVX Corporation operate large‑scale fabs in Taiwan and mainland China. Their economies of scale allow them to price units near $0.10 while still meeting the basic voltage‑withstand specifications required by industrial control and consumer‑appliance applications. Some have begun to specialize in niche structurese.g., sulfurization‑resistant filmsto differentiate their offerings within the crowded mid‑range market.

Regional Analysis: High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ors Market

Europe

European manufacturers have consolidated their position in High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ors Market through a blend of legacy engineering expertise and targeted investment in precision production lines. The region benefits from a dense network of OEMs in automotive, aerospace, and industrial automation, each demanding tighter tolerance and superior thermal stability. Regulatory alignment across the EU promotes the use of lead‑free components, nudging suppliers toward carbon‑film technologies that balance reliability with cost efficiency. Moreover, the presence of several research consortia accelerates material‑science breakthroughs, enabling incremental improvements in voltage rating without compromising size. While the broader semiconductor ecosystem faces capacity constraints, Europe’s focus on niche high‑voltage applications sustains demand, prompting firms to fine‑tune their value propositions around custom specifications and short‑lead deliveries. The cumulative effect is a resilient market segment that continues to attract mid‑size players seeking to leverage the region’s engineering ecosystem.

Automotive Applications
The push toward electric drivetrains intensifies the need for robust high‑voltage resistor stacks in power‑train control units. European car makers favour carbon‑film variants for their stable performance under rapid thermal cycling, a requirement that drives OEM‑supplier collaboration on bespoke form factors.
Industrial Power Supplies
Factories upgrading to digitized control architectures rely on precise voltage regulation. Carbon‑film resistors offer the low drift needed for motor‑drive converters, prompting equipment manufacturers to embed them as standard components in new product lines.
Aerospace & Defense
Mission‑critical platforms demand components that survive extreme altitude and temperature swings. The European defence sector values carbon‑film resistors for their proven track record in reliability, leading to longer procurement cycles but higher unit spend.
Renewable Energy Systems
Inverter modules for wind and solar farms increasingly incorporate high‑voltage resistors to manage surge protection. The continent’s aggressive renewable targets translate into design preferences that prioritize the stability of carbon‑film technology.

North America
North American demand for High Voltage Carbon Film Resistors is shaped by a strong emphasis on innovation within the defense and aerospace sectors. Defense contractors prioritize parts that can endure rigorous testing standards, leading to a preference for carbon‑film solutions with documented long‑term reliability. Simultaneously, the continent’s burgeoning data‑center infrastructure imposes tighter voltage control requirements, encouraging system integrators to adopt resistors that maintain consistent performance under high‑density power loads. Supplier strategies therefore focus on rapid prototyping capabilities and flexible supply agreements to meet the fast‑paced development cycles characteristic of the region.

Asia‑Pacific
The Asia‑Pacific corridor exhibits a blend of high‑volume manufacturing and emerging high‑precision markets. While mass‑produced electronic goods drive baseline demand, countries such as Japan and South Korea invest heavily in automotive electrification and advanced robotics, where voltage accuracy is non‑negotiable. Local firms are expanding material‑science labs to refine carbon‑film formulations, aiming to reduce tolerance drift. This dual‑track approach creates a market environment where volume‑oriented producers coexist with niche players catering to ultra‑reliable applications, prompting distributors to segment their portfolios accordingly.

South America
In South America, the market remains modest but is buoyed by infrastructure projects that require durable high‑voltage components. Power‑grid modernization initiatives inspire utilities to replace aging resistor stocks with carbon‑film alternatives that promise longer service intervals. Additionally, a growing electronics assembly sector in Brazil leverages cost‑effective carbon‑film options to meet regional price sensitivity while still delivering acceptable performance for consumer‑grade devices.

Middle East & Africa
The Middle East & Africa region reflects a pattern where oil‑related industries and emerging renewable projects intersect. High‑temperature environments typical of desert installations place a premium on resistor materials that resist thermal degradation, positioning carbon‑film technology as a pragmatic choice. Meanwhile, renewable‑energy pilots in the Gulf states incorporate these resistors within inverter designs to safeguard against voltage spikes, fostering a niche but technically sophisticated demand segment.
